Summary

A gripping story from Kevin Crossley-Holland for Egmont’s red banana series. Every day Annie walks by the lonely marsh from her remote cottage to school. Annie tells Willa the names of local plants and Willa tells Annie about the ghost, murdered by highwaymen, who is said to haunt the old forge nearby.

Kevin Crossley-Holland Kevin Crossley-Holland has published several outstanding collections of myths, legends, and folktales, and is an award-winning poet and author of children's books. His Arthur trilogy was translated into 23 languages, and has sold more than one million copies worldwide. Alan Marks Alan Marks has illustrated books for many children's authors, including Kevin Crossley-Holland and Jane Goodall.
